- The distance between Summerside, Pe, Canada and Base Orcadas, Antarctica is approximately 12,041 km or 7,483 mi.
- To reach Summerside, Pe in this distance one would set out from Base Orcadas bearing 346.3°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Summerside, Pe bearing 350.3° or N .
- Summerside, Pe has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Base Orcadas has a tundra climate (ET).
- The annual average temperature is 9.3 °C (16.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.2 °C (29.2°F) more in Summerside, Pe.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 398.4 mm (15.7 in) more which is equivalent to 398.4 l/m² (9.78 US gal/ft²) or 3,984,000 l/ha (425,916 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.9° higher in Summerside, Pe than in Base Orcadas.
